stop
Category: Browser Control
Namespace: web.browser.stop
Description
Stop loading the current page. This cancels any ongoing page load or navigation.
Syntax
await web.browser.stop();
Parameters
None
Returns
Promise<boolean> - Returns true when operation completes
Example
Simple example
await web.browser.stop();
Practical example
document.getElementById('stop-btn').addEventListener('click', async () => {
await web.browser.stop();
});
Advanced example
async function cancelNavigation() {
console.log('Stopping page load...');
await web.browser.stop();
const url = await web.browser.getCurrentUrl();
console.log('Stopped at:', url);
}
Use Cases
- Cancel slow page loads
- Stop navigation in progress
- Implement stop button
- Cancel unwanted navigation
- Stop loading resources
- Interrupt page loading
- Implement keyboard shortcuts (Esc)
- Cancel failed loads
Related Methods
web.browser.navigate()web.browser.reload()
Notes
- Part of browser control functionality
- Asynchronous operation
- Returns promise